#50cbe3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50cbe3 is composed of 31.4% red, 79.6%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 10.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 189.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 60.2%. #50cbe3 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#0097c7.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#50cbe3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50cbe3 has RGB values of R:80, G:203,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5295075.

Shades and Tints of #50cbe3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090b is the darkest color, while #f9fd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#50cbe3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969c9d is the less saturated color, while #39dbfa is the most saturated one.
